Can rice fix a wet iPhone, and does swiping apps out improve an iPhone’s battery life? The short answer to both of these is no, and Leigh Stark is appearing on radio to talk why.

For the longest time, people have been using rice to fix a drenched and drowned and water-logged phone, but Apple is now advising against it. Why is this happening, and what’s Apple talking about?

And can you really make the battery of an iPhone last for longer by swiping apps out that you’re not using?

Pickr’s editor Leigh Stark joins Tony Moclair on 3AW Afternoons to talk about both of these a segment you can hear below.
